Output 5d76e2f0c7c29c65c20d9da89f63dd1b732aba135bdd1af40eb80a9c55246032:120

value
155114
script pubkey
OP_HASH160 OP_PUSHBYTES_20 178ae3a163513e88a16ed65b1441ed0f80777804 OP_EQUAL
address
33qVr9PDY3h7QHccmV9n1L92Q6XqcjEJYC
transaction
5d76e2f0c7c29c65c20d9da89f63dd1b732aba135bdd1af40eb80a9c55246032
confirmations
163975
spent
true